W jakim języku pisane są aplikacje na Androida?
W jakim języku pisane są aplikacje na Androida?

# W jakim języku pisane są aplikacje na Androida?

## Wprowadzenie

Tworzenie aplikacji na Androida jest niezwykle popularne w dzisiejszych czasach. Wielu programistów zastanawia się, w jakim języku najlepiej pisać aplikacje na tę platformę. W tym artykule dowiesz się, jakie języki są najczęściej używane do tworzenia aplikacji na Androida i jakie są ich zalety i wady.

## Języki programowania do tworzenia aplikacji na Androida

### 1. Java

Java jest najpopularniejszym językiem programowania do tworzenia aplikacji na Androida. Jest to język obiektowy, który oferuje wiele narzędzi i bibliotek, ułatwiających tworzenie zaawansowanych aplikacji. Java jest również łatwa do nauki, dzięki czemu jest popularna wśród początkujących programistów.

#### Zalety:
– Duża społeczność programistów, co ułatwia znalezienie pomocy i rozwiązanie problemów.
– Bogata dokumentacja i wiele dostępnych zasobów edukacyjnych.
– Wysoka wydajność i stabilność aplikacji.

#### Wady:
– Skomplikowana składnia, która może być trudna do opanowania dla początkujących.
– Konieczność korzystania z wirtualnej maszyny Java (JVM), co może wpływać na wydajność aplikacji.

### 2. Kotlin

Kotlin to stosunkowo nowy język programowania, który zyskuje coraz większą popularność wśród programistów Androida. Jest on w pełni kompatybilny z Javą, co oznacza, że istnieje możliwość łączenia kodu napisanego w obu językach. Kotlin oferuje wiele nowoczesnych funkcji, które ułatwiają pisanie czytelnego i bezpiecznego kodu.

#### Zalety:
– Czysta i zwięzła składnia, co przyspiesza proces programowania.
– Bezpieczny kod dzięki eliminacji wielu potencjalnych błędów.
– Wysoka wydajność i kompatybilność z Javą.

#### Wady:
– Mniejsza społeczność programistów w porównaniu do Javy, co może utrudniać znalezienie pomocy.
– Mniej dostępnych zasobów edukacyjnych w porównaniu do Javy.

### 3. C++

C++ jest językiem programowania, który jest często wykorzystywany do tworzenia aplikacji na Androida, które wymagają wysokiej wydajności. Jest to język niskopoziomowy, który umożliwia bezpośredni dostęp do zasobów sprzętowych urządzenia.

#### Zalety:
– Bardzo wysoka wydajność, idealna do tworzenia gier i aplikacji graficznych.
– Bezpośredni dostęp do zasobów sprzętowych urządzenia.
– Możliwość ponownego wykorzystania kodu C++ napisanego dla innych platform.

#### Wady:
– Skomplikowana składnia, która może być trudna do opanowania dla początkujących.
– Brak automatycznego zarządzania pamięcią, co może prowadzić do wycieków pamięci i innych problemów.

## Podsumowanie

W jakim języku pisane są aplikacje na Androida? Odpowiedź na to pytanie zależy od preferencji programisty i wymagań projektu. Java jest najpopularniejszym językiem do tworzenia aplikacji na Androida, ale Kotlin zyskuje coraz większą popularność ze względu na swoje nowoczesne funkcje. C++ jest często wykorzystywany do tworzenia aplikacji wymagających wysokiej wydajności. Bez względu na wybrany język, ważne jest, aby dobrze poznać jego zalety i wady oraz zrozumieć, jakie są wymagania projektu, aby podjąć najlepszą decyzję.

Aplikacje na Androida są zazwyczaj pisane w języku Java lub Kotlin.

Oto link tagu HTML do strony https://4emotion.pl/:
https://4emotion.pl/

ZOSTAW ODPOWIEDŹ

Please enter your comment!
Please enter your name here